A light-year is a unit of distance. It is the distance that light can travel in one year. Light moves at a velocity of about 300,000 kilometers (km) each second. So in one year, it can travel about 10 trillion km.

light-year (NASA SP-7, 1965) A unit of length used in expressing stellar distances equal to the distance electromagnetic radiation travels in 1 year. 1 light-year = 9.460 X 10E12 kilometers = 63,280 astronomical units = 0.3068 parsecs.

The galactic disk has a diameter of about 100,000 light-years (see 1 E20 m for a list of comparable distances). The distance from the Sun to the galactic center is about 27,700 light-years.

Our own galactic cluster, the Local Group, is about 5 million light-years across and contains about 30 galaxies (the largest of which are the Andromeda galaxy, Triangulum, and our Milky Way).
